Glass sinks are becoming more and more commonplace in contemporary bathrooms
and kitchens. Elegant, sophisticated and versatile, glass sinks are available in
a wide variety of colors, shapes, sizes and styles. Whether your aesthetic leans
toward stark modern designs or warm traditional flavors, rest assured there is a
glass sink to suit your preference and complete your space.

Unlike "production sinks", Sinks Gallery artists incorporate old world glass
making techniques. Many vessels are hand blown--something not generally found in
most showrooms. Other glass artists utilize a process known as "slumping &
fusing". Time consuming and painstaking, this process consists of fusing
together different pieces of glass (creating various patterns and colors). Only
once all the pieces of glass have been fused together to create a solid sheet
can that sheet be slumped into the desired vessel shape. Although they could
easily utilize a simpler approach, Sinks Gallery's dedication to quality and
ideal design in its decorative glass sinks is one of the many reasons it stands
above the rest.
